Hey folks — handing off LiftPath release duties to Mara while I'm out. The elevator-dispatch simulator ships Thursdays; build 4.2 is staged and the scenario packs are frozen. Only gotcha: the dispatch-core artifact won't promote unless it's signed before the smoke suite kicks off, so do that first, not after. Everything else is in the runbook on the Ostermill wiki. Mara, you'll need the deploy key to push to the release channel, so pasting it here for the sync notes.

deploy key for tawip-bawig: bky13_1zSxDtVxnNkjh

# Timezone handling for Lumenreport exports:
# All report timestamps are stored in UTC in the Pellwick warehouse, but
# customers expect exports rendered in their account's configured zone.
# Do NOT convert in SQL — the Lumenreport client handles DST boundaries
# and half-hour offsets correctly, and double conversion has bitten us twice.
# Always pass the raw UTC values and the account zone string to the client.
# The client authenticates against the internal Zoneframe service using the
# key on the next line.

gateway credential: kto3_qfe

Subject: DR drill results — Skellig metrics sidecar

Team, ahead of Wednesday's eng sync: last week we ran the quarterly disaster-recovery drill on the Skellig aggregation sidecar. Failover to the Norbrook standby completed in 4m12s, within target, though two dashboards showed stale rollups for ten minutes. Action items are tracked on the Skellig board. For the sync, anyone re-running the drill against the standby cluster should unseal its config store using the recovery passphrase below.

strongbox words: gilok-druion-briath-wendor-briion-prawyn-fenion-oliir-casdor-holius-briius-gilath-gilael-pelys